Profile

Javid provides his domestic and international clients with a wide range of services including corporate board representation, corporate and commercial dispute resolution, mediation, arbitration and litigation, as well as land use, construction and environmental permitting litigation. 

Javid assists companies and individuals from across the United States and the globe, including Europe, Asia and the Middle East with contract and corporate disputes, business divorce, insurance coverage, commercial real estate development disputes governed under New York Law and the litigation necessary to resolve those disputes in state or federal courts. Javid works closely with company principals or their in-house counsel to identify strategic goals, provide sound legal advice to decision makers, then formulate and execute the tactical plans necessary to achieve the client’s intended goals. 

Javid represents commercial developers, property owners, cooperatives and condominiums throughout the state and in New York City, assisting clients with corporate governance issues, finance, shareholder/unit holder dispute resolution, contractor disputes, sponsor disputes, real estate, permitting, and buildings violations, including litigation matters at both trial level and appellate level courts. Javid has appeared before all levels of courts in New York City and Brooklyn to advocate for his client’s rights. 

Javid also works with individuals, companies and municipalities providing representation and litigation related to municipal and environmental permitting of commercial development, rezoning, annexation, environmental review, and other municipal or land use issues. Javid has appeared before state courts and administrative agencies such as the NYS Department of Environmental Conservation, the NYS Department of State, and NYS Department of Labor. Javid has successfully overturned wrongful denials of municipal and environmental permits and defended challenged permits through Article 78 reviews, declaratory judgment actions, and appellate review. 

Outside of Bond, Javid serves as an Officer in the United Stated Army (Reserves) Judge Advocate General (JAG) Corps and is a member of the Knox Volunteer Fire Department. 

Representative Matters

  • Representation of domestic and international clients related to commercial and corporate disputes, business torts, and business divorce. 
  • Representation related to cooperatives and condominiums, assisting clients with corporate governance, finance, shareholder/unit holder dispute resolution issues, contractor disputes, sponsor disputes, real estate, permitting, and buildings violations, including litigation matters at both trial level and appellate level courts. 
  • Representation related to prosecution and defense of construction defect claims, insurance contract disputes, and property damage claims. 
  • Representation related to municipal and environmental permitting for commercial development, infrastructure projects, energy projects, including rezoning, annexation, and environmental review.
  • Representation related to compliance, enforcement and litigation under state and federal environmental laws, including SEQRA, CERCLA, SPDES, Title V, NYS Oil Spill Act, state solid and hazardous waste laws, mineral resources, and water pollution and control laws and regulations. 
  • Representation of municipal boards and city councils, planning boards, and zoning boards, to assist with permit issuance and denials, municipal representation, including successful defense of a municipal government against multi-million dollar federal civil rights law suit. 
  • Representation related administrative adjudication and hearings, assisting clients with party status, permit denials, and civil/criminal enforcement actions, including legislative hearings, issues conferences, discovery, motion practice, adjudication, and appeals.
  • Trial counsel to prosecute federal claims under Americans with Disabilities Act and U.S. Constitution.
